  • Circulating Secretoneurin Concentrations After Cardiac Surgery : Data From the FINNish Acute Kidney Injury Heart Study
  • 2019
  • Ingår i: Critical Care Medicine. - 0090-3493 .- 1530-0293. ; 47:5, s. E412-E419
  • Tidskriftsartikel (refereegranskat)abstract
    • Objectives:Secretoneurin is associated with cardiomyocyte Ca2+ handling and improves risk prediction in patients with acute myocardial dysfunction. Whether secretoneurin improves risk assessment on top of established cardiac biomarkers and European System for Cardiac Operative Risk Evaluation II in patients undergoing cardiac surgery is not known.Design:Prospective, observational, single-center sub-study of a multicenter study.Setting:Prospective observational study of survival in patients undergoing cardiac surgery.Patients:A total of 619 patients undergoing cardiac surgery.Interventions:Patients underwent either isolated coronary artery bypass graft surgery, single noncoronary artery bypass graft surgery, two procedures, or three or more procedures. Procedures other than coronary artery bypass graft were valve surgery, surgery on thoracic aorta, and other cardiac surgery.Measurements and Main Results:We measured preoperative and postoperative secretoneurin concentrations and adjusted for European System for Cardiac Operative Risk Evaluation II, N-terminal pro-B-type natriuretic peptide, and cardiac troponin T concentrations in multivariate analyses. During 961 days of follow- up, 59 patients died (9.5%). Secretoneurin concentrations were higher among nonsurvivors compared with survivors, both before (168 pmol/L [quartile 1-3, 147-206 pmol/L] vs 160 pmol/L [131-193 pmol/L]; p = 0.039) and after cardiac surgery (173 pmol/L [129-217 pmol/L] vs 143 pmol/L [111-173 pmol/L]; p < 0.001). Secretoneurin concentrations decreased from preoperative to postoperative measurements in survivors, whereas we observed no significant decrease in secretoneurin concentrations among nonsurvivors. Secretoneurin concentrations were weakly correlated with established risk indices. Patients with the highest postoperative secretoneurin concentrations had worse outcome compared with patients with lower secretoneurin concentrations (p < 0.001 by the log-rank test) and postoperative secretoneurin concentrations were associated with time to death in multivariate Cox regression analysis: hazard ratio ln secretoneurin 2.96 (95% CI, 1.46-5.99; p = 0.003). Adding postoperative secretoneurin concentrations to European System for Cardiac Operative Risk Evaluation II improved patient risk stratification, as assessed by the integrated discrimination index: 0.023 (95% CI, 0.0043-0.041; p = 0.016).Conclusions:Circulating postoperative secretoneurin concentrations provide incremental prognostic information to established risk indices in patients undergoing cardiac surgery.

  • Prognostic value of chromogranin A in severe sepsis : data from the FINNSEPSIS study
  • 2012
  • Ingår i: Intensive Care Medicine. - : Springer Science and Business Media LLC. - 0342-4642 .- 1432-1238. ; 38:5, s. 820-829
  • Tidskriftsartikel (refereegranskat)abstract
    • To assess the prognostic information of chromogranin A (CgA), a marker associated with adrenergic tone and myocardial function, in patients with severe sepsis. CgA levels were measured at the time of study inclusion and 72 h later in 232 patients with severe sepsis recruited from 24 ICUs in Finland (FINNSEPSIS study). Sixty-five patients (28 %) died during the index hospitalization. CgA levels at inclusion and after 72 h correlated with several established indices of risk in sepsis. Patients who died during the hospitalization had higher baseline CgA levels than hospital survivors: 14.0 (Q1-3, 7.4-27.4) versus 9.1 (5.9-15.8) nmol/l, P = 0.002, and after 72 h: 16.2 (9.0-31.1) versus 9.8 (6.0-18.0) nmol/l, P = 0.001. Prior cardiovascular disease (P = 0.04) and cardiovascular SOFA levels on day 3 (P = 0.03) were associated with higher CgA levels after 72 h by linear regression. CgA levels on study inclusion and after 72 h were independently associated with hospital mortality by logistic regression: OR (logarithmically transformed CgA levels) 1.95 (95 % CI 1.01-3.77), P = 0.046 and OR 2.03 (95 % CI 1.18-3.49), P = 0.01, respectively. The prognostic accuracy was comparable for CgA measurements and SAPS II score, and the addition of CgA measurements to the SAPS II score improved risk stratification of the patients as assessed by the category-free net reclassification index. A CgA level > 6.6 nmol/l on study inclusion was associated with septic shock during the hospitalization. CgA levels measured during hospitalization for severe sepsis are associated with cardiovascular dysfunction and may provide additional prognostic information in patients with severe sepsis.
